Reading the bonus mechanics without the spin

A proper welcome offer should reward your first deposit without locking you into a maze of conditions that make cashing out feel impossible. The best operators keep wagering requirements reasonable, usually somewhere in the 25x to 35x range on the bonus amount, and they apply them to specific game categories rather than expecting you to burn through every spin on high-variance pokies. Look for clear terms around max bet limits while a bonus is active, because some sites quietly restrict you to $2 or $5 per round, which turns a decent package into a frustrating grind. Payment matching matters too – a site that only credits bonuses to certain methods while leaving your actual deposit on a different timeline is asking you to do the reconciliation work yourself. If the terms don’t spell out how and when the bonus converts to real withdrawable balance, treat that as a warning sign rather than a minor oversight.

Licensing and security you can actually verify

Any operator worth your time should hold a licence you can trace back to a regulator’s public register, not just a logo on the footer that looks official. In Australia, that means checking whether the site’s jurisdiction aligns with what the ACMA outlines for gambling services, and understanding that offshore operators aren’t licensed or regulated here – you’re relying on their own compliance standards instead. Security should cover SSL encryption, clear privacy policies that explain how your data gets used, and account controls like two-factor authentication that let you lock down access without jumping through hoops. Support that answers before you have to chase

A solid welcome package means little if you can’t get a straight answer when something goes sideways. Look for live chat that’s staffed during Australian hours, a phone line that doesn’t route you through a generic call centre in a timezone six hours behind yours, and email responses that actually address your query instead of sending you in circles. When I’ve reviewed campaign flows for players hitting their first withdrawal, the ones with genuine support teams resolve verification questions in a day or two; the ones without it leave people staring at pending statuses for a week. Responsible-play tools that aren’t buried in the footer

Deposit limits, session reminders, cool-off periods and self-exclusion options should be easy to find and easy to set, not hidden behind three menus and a help article nobody reads. A responsible operator builds these tools into the account setup flow, not as an afterthought for people who’ve already hit trouble. Working out whether a package fits your play style

Not every offer suits every player, and the right fit depends on how you actually gamble rather than how the marketing makes it sound. If you’re a casual player who logs in a few times a month and prefers table games or low-variance pokies, a package with a lower wagering requirement and a clear conversion path matters more than a big headline number. High-rollers chasing bigger match percentages need to check whether the bonus applies across the full game library or only to a narrow set of titles, because restrictions there can wipe out the value before you’ve spun twice. Registration should be straightforward enough that you’re not handing over documents you’re uncomfortable sharing, and mobile play should work without forcing you into a clunky app when the browser version does the job fine.
